Latest Patents
Nakamura's latest patents include a biological-signal detecting device and a rechargeable battery pack and charger unit combination. The rechargeable battery pack is designed to be detachable from the charger unit, allowing for efficient charging under the control of a sophisticated charging circuit. This battery pack features a sensor output circuit that includes a temperature sensor, which monitors the temperature of the battery during charging. The voltage dividing resistor network in the sensor output circuit receives a constant current from the charging circuit when the battery pack is attached to the charger unit. This setup provides an enable signal to the charging circuit, allowing charging at a first rate as long as the battery temperature remains below a predetermined reference level. If the temperature exceeds this level, the network generates a stop signal to inhibit charging, ensuring safety and efficiency.
Career Highlights
Katsuji Nakamura is associated with Matsushita Electric Works, Ltd., a company renowned for its advancements in electrical and electronic products. His work at this esteemed organization has allowed him to develop innovative solutions that address contemporary challenges in battery technology.
Collaborations
Throughout his career, Nakamura has collaborated with talented individuals such as Masami Kitamura and Kouichi Iwanaga. These partnerships have fostered a creative environment that has led to the development of groundbreaking technologies.
